Product Introduction

Overview

The SN74LVC245APWRE4, produced by Texas Instruments, is an octal bus transceiver with 3-state outputs designed for asynchronous communication between data buses. This device operates within a voltage range of 1.65 V to 3.6 V and supports mixed-mode signal operation, allowing it to handle 5-V input/output voltages with a 3.3-V VCC. It is particularly useful in applications requiring high-speed data transfer and robust signal integrity.

Key Features

  • Operates from 1.65 V to 3.6 V
  • Inputs accept voltages up to 5.5 V
  • Maximum propagation delay time of 6.3 ns at 3.3 V
  • Supports mixed-mode signal operation on all ports
  • Latch-up performance exceeds 250 mA per JESD 17
  • ESD protection exceeds JESD 22 (2000-V Human-Body Model, 1000-V Charged-Device Model)
  • Live insertion, partial-power-down mode, and back drive protection supported
  • Typical output ground bounce (VOLP) < 0.8 V at VCC = 3.3 V, TA = 25°C
  • Typical output voltage overshoot (VOHV) > 2 V at VCC = 3.3 V, TA = 25°C

  10. How does the direction control work in the SN74LVC245APWRE4? The direction control (DIR) pin determines the direction of signal propagation. When high, the signal propagates from A to B, and when low, it propagates from B to A.
